A man who vanished from Auckland Airport on Friday morning after never boarding his domestic flight has been found safe.
A search for Kory-Dean Wirihana was sparked on Friday after he checked in for a domestic flight at Auckland Airport, cleared security, but never boarded the plane. Photo / Supplied

Police confirmed Wirihana had been located in the Auckland region and was “safe and well”.
With no phone, no transportation and no confirmed sightings since the early hours of Friday morning, his family believed he had “literally disappeared from the airport”.
They also expressed concern for Wirihana’s mental health, saying he had been struggling following the recent loss of his husband.
